Output 6840abe1f0afd6f5c423363e182746efbc9c519c89c621b5b0da39071345a648:0

value
66085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a073435781a5aea5fbcbc52c9ae346fe92acd622 OP_EQUAL
address
3GKQ7rV9oozRdMPGtnMNz6rrtkEjNf1vvP
transaction
6840abe1f0afd6f5c423363e182746efbc9c519c89c621b5b0da39071345a648